Hey guys! Looking for someone who has bought a V2 camper built for a 3rd Gen and put it on their 2nd gen Tacoma. I have heard that’s it’s compatible if you switch out the rear panel. I reached out to GFC and according to them they are functionally compatible but the fit is not seemless. Needless to say I am curious to if anyone has actually done this and what their thoughts are on the overall fit. Cheers!
Not exactly your situation, but I transferred my v2 camper that was built for a 2nd gen to a 3rd gen earlier this year without issue. I did work with GFC to replace the rear panel and everything is a great fit.
I have a friend that did this. It is functional. He opted to not get a replacement panel and closed up the extra gap over the tailgate with some weatherstripping. If you plan to do a full buildout, I wouldn’t recommend it due to waterproofness, but if you’re just clapping it on a truck it does fine.

I have a V2 Pro meant for a 3rd Gen on my 2nd Gen and it works. The gasket/seal on the back hatch panel needs to be modified but otherwise no issues.
